The United States is set to deport a first group of 25 migrants from third countries to Paraguay on Thursday. This action is being carried out under a new migration cooperation agreement signed between the two nations. Paraguay's foreign ministry confirmed the arrival of the group, marking the initial implementation of the deal. The agreement represents a new avenue for the US to manage migration flows by deporting individuals to partner countries in the region.
